2 points) Trivia: In electronics, a vacuum tube (aka electron tube) is a device controlling electric current through a vacuum in a sealed container. Before invention of semiconductor electronic elements all electronic devices (including TV's, computers, audio amplifiers, critical military and space equipment) were based on vacuum tubes. Even today highly critical devices (eg. tube amplifiers for audiophiles) are still based on vacuum tubes. A simple tube contains only two elements; current can only flow in one direction through the device between the two electrodes, as electrons emitted by the hot cathode (negative electrode) travel through the tube and are collected by the anode (positive electrode). Problem: In a particular vacuum tube electrons hit the anode at a rate of6.0 × 1012 electrons per second. What is the current in this system? Express your answer as a positive number in HA.

Explanation / Answer

Electricity is rate of flow of charge =dq/dt

each electron carries 1.6*10^-19 C of charge

In 1 second 6*10^12 electrons carry 6*10^12 * 1.6*10^-19 =9.6*10^-7 A = 0.96*10^-6 A = 0.96 micro amperes
